Sourcing guidance for Oem Tent
What technical specifications are critical when customizing an OEM tent for professional outdoor use?
When sourcing OEM tents, you must prioritize fabric density and coating technology. For the rainfly, a minimum of 210T Ripstop Polyester or Nylon with a PU (Polyurethane) coating of at least 3000mm is recommended to ensure waterproof performance. For the frame, 7001 or 7075 Aluminum Alloy poles offer the best strength-to-weight ratio compared to fiberglass. Additionally, ensure all seams are heat-taped and stress points are reinforced with double-stitching to prevent tearing under high wind loads.
How can I ensure the OEM tent meets international safety and quality standards?
Compliance is non-negotiable for cross-border trade. You should verify that the manufacturer adheres to ISO 9001 for quality management. For specific markets, ensure the materials meet CPAI-84 or EN 5912 flammability standards. If you are targeting eco-conscious consumers, request OEKO-TEX Standard 100 or REACH certifications to confirm the absence of harmful chemicals in the dyes and coatings.
What customization options should I discuss with an OEM supplier to differentiate my brand?
Beyond simple logo printing (silk screen or heat transfer), focus on functional differentiation. Discuss ventilation system designs (such as high-low venting), integrated LED lighting pockets, and internal storage organizers. For high-end markets, ask about Black-out coating technology which blocks 99% of sunlight, or modular designs that allow multiple tents to be connected. Providing your own CAD drawings or 3D models will significantly improve the accuracy of the first prototype.
How do I evaluate the durability and performance of a sample tent?
Conduct a hydrostatic head test to verify waterproof ratings and a wind tunnel simulation if possible. Check the zipper brand; high-quality OEM tents typically use YKK or SBS zippers for smooth operation. Inspect the mesh density (B3 or higher) to ensure it is fine enough to keep out small insects while maintaining airflow. Finally, perform a setup/pack-down trial to assess the intuition of the design and the quality of the carry bag.
Cross-Border Procurement Strategy & Risk Management for OEM Tents
What are the primary risks when sourcing OEM tents from overseas suppliers?
The most common risks include material substitution (using lower-grade polyester than sampled) and intellectual property (IP) infringement. To mitigate these, use a detailed Purchase Order (PO) that specifies exact material weights and brands. For IP protection, ensure you have a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A) in place before sharing proprietary designs. How should I negotiate pricing and MOQs for a new OEM project?
OEM projects usually require a Minimum Order Quantity (MOQ) of 300-500 units due to fabric dyeing runs. To negotiate, offer a staged volume commitment where the price drops as your total annual volume increases. Always ask for breakdown pricing (material, labor, packaging, and testing) to identify where costs can be optimized. If the MOQ is too high, suggest using stock fabric colors to reduce the supplier's risk and your initial investment.
What logistics and shipping precautions should be taken for bulk tent orders?
Tents are relatively heavy and bulky, so sea freight (LCL or FCL) is the most economical method. Ensure the supplier uses heavy-duty 5-layer corrugated export cartons and palletization to prevent crushing during transit. Request moisture-absorbent silica gel packets in every tent bag to prevent mold growth during long sea voyages. For customs, ensure the HS Code (typically 6306.22) is correctly declared to avoid tariff penalties.
How can I secure my transaction and ensure quality before final payment?
Never pay 100% upfront. The industry standard is a 30% deposit and 70% balance against the Bill of Lading (B/L) or after a successful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I). Hire a third-party inspection agency (like SGS or Intertek) to visit the factory and perform a Random Sampling Inspection based on AQL 2.5/4.0 standards.
